O-1943-5-01ORDINANCE NO. 1943-5-01 ' AN ORDINANCE OF TH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F ALLEN, COLLIN COUNTY, TEXAS, AMENDING THE CODE OF ORDINANCES, BY AMENDING CHAPTER 9, "MOTOR VEHICLES AND TRAFFIC," ARTICLE V, "OPERATION OF VEHICLES," DIVISION 2, "SPEED REGULATIONS," SECTION 9-135(4 TO ESTABLISH THE MAXIMUM PRIMA FACIE SPEED LIMIT FOR STATE HIGHWAY 5 (GREENVILLE AVENUE) WITHIN THE CORPORATE LIMITS OF THE CITY OF ALLEN; PROVIDING FOR A REPEALING CLAUSE; PROVIDING A SEVERABILITY CLAUSE; PROVIDING FOR A PENALTY OF FINE NOT TO EXCEED THE SUM OF TWO HUNDRED DOLLARS ($200) FOR EACH OFFENSE; AND PROVIDING FOR AN EFFECTIVE DATE. WHEREAS, Section 545.356 of the Transportation Code, provides that whenever the governing body of the City shall determine upon the basis of an engineering and traffic investigation that any prima facie speed therein set forth is greater or less than is reasonable in safe under the conditions found to exist at any intersection or other place or upon any part of a street or lughway within the City, fairing into consideration the width and condition of the pavement and other circumstances on such portion of said street or highway, as well as the usual traffic thereon, said governing body may determine and declare a reasonable and safe prima facie speed limit thereat or thereon by the passage of an ordinance, which shall be effective when appropriate signs giving notice thereof are erected at such intersection or other place m par of the street or highway; and, WHEREAS, the City Council of the City of Allen, Texas, upon the basis of an engineering and traffic investigation finds it necessary to alter prima facie maximum speed limits established by Section 545.356 of the Transportation Code, the following prima facie speed limits hereafter indicated for vehicles are hereby determined and declared to be reasonable and safe; and such speed limits are hereby fixed at the rate of speed indicated for vehicles traveling upon the named streets and highways, or parts thereof. N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T ORDAINED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F ALLEN, COLLIN COUNTY, TEXAS, THAT: SECTION 1. The Code of Ordinances of the City of Allen, Texas, be and the same is hereby amended by amending Chapter 9, "Motor Vehicles and Traffic," Article V, "Operation of Vehicles," Division 2, "Speed Regulations," Section 9-135(a) "Streets other than expressways and freeways," in part to establish the maximum prima facie speed limit upon State Highway 5 (Greenville Avenue), to read as follows: "Sec. 9-135 Streets other than expressways and freeways. (a) A person commits an offense if he operates or drives a vehicle on the following designated streets at a speed greater than the speed designated by this section for that street or portion of that street, and any speed in excess of the limit provided in this section shall be prima facie evidence that the speed is not reasonable nor prudent and is unlawful: Street Extent Speed ' State Hwy. 5 Beginning at a point (station 59+64) being the north 45 (Greenville Avenue) city limits of the City of Allen, and continuing along State Highway 5 in a southerly direction approximately 4.593 miles to a point (station 272+00) being the south city limits of the City of Allen SECTION 2. The Traffic Engineer shall erect appropriate signage giving notice of the maximum prima facie speed limit established herein. SECTION 3. All ordinances of the City of Allen in conflict wtth the provisions of this ordinance shall be, and the same are hereby, repealed; provided, however, that all othff provisions of said ordinances not to conflict herewith shall remain in full force and effect. SECTION 4. Should any word, sentence, paragraph, subdivision, clause, phrase or section of this ordinance or of the Code of Ordinances, as amended hereby, be adjudged or held to be void or unconstitutional, the same shall not affect the validity of the remaining portions of said ordinance or the Code of Ordinances, as amended hereby, which shall remain in full force and effect. SECTION 5. An offense committed before the effective date of dus ordinance is governed by prior law and the provisions of the Code of Ordinances, as amended, in effect when the offense was committed and the former law is continued to effect for this purpose. SECTION 6. Any person, firm or corporation violating any of the provisions or terms of this ordinance or of the Code of Ordinances as amended hereby, shall be subject to the same penalty as provided for in the Code of Ordmances of the City of Allen, as previously amended, and upon conviction shall be punished by a ' fine not to exceed the sum of Two Hundred Dollars ($200) for each offense. SECTION 7. This ordinance shall take effect immediately from and after its passage and publication as required by law, however the maximum prima facie speed limit established herein shall not take effect until the Traffic Engineer has erected appropriate signage giving notice of the maximum prima facie speed limits therefore and it is accordingly so ordained.
